Transaction 6c50f5629c6d33e75d40baefb70e2df0a8659fdb3028d2ec8723bec285a3785c

8 Input
2 Outputs
  • 6c50f5629c6d33e75d40baefb70e2df0a8659fdb3028d2ec8723bec285a3785c:0
  • value  50716126
    address  34WWUTXYe4m4yCxhcCzBv9C1vSSPtoDosR
  • 6c50f5629c6d33e75d40baefb70e2df0a8659fdb3028d2ec8723bec285a3785c:1
  • value  277278
    address  3Lmtg2q5QvWEmpsmoyFrLUqu8aGHTvHGfM